Big Rapids, Mich. - The Ferris State University women's basketball squad will take part in the Great Lakes Intercollegiate Athletic Conference (GLIAC) Tournament for the fourth consecutive year as the Bulldogs travel to face Parkside on Tuesday (March 2) night for a league first-round game in Kenosha, Wis.

The ninth-seeded Bulldogs will square off against the eighth-seeded Rangers at DeSimone Gymnasium with tipoff slated for 4 p.m. (ET).

Ferris State owns a current 6-12 overall record to date this season under first-year head coach Kurt Westendorp. Meanwhile, Parkside heads into the opening round with an 9-9 overall ledger.

Earlier this year, the two teams split a league regular-season series with a pair of high-scoring and tightly-contested matchups at FSU's Jim Wink Arena with the Rangers winning the opener on Jan. 15 by a 86-82 score and FSU taking the rematch the following day on Jan. 16 by a score of 91-89.

Per GLIAC COVID-19 protocols, no fans will be allowed for any round of the GLIAC Tournament this season.

This year, all 12 teams earned berths into the GLIAC Tournament. Four first-round games will be played on Tuesday with the winners advancing to the GLIAC Tournament Quarterfinals set for Thursday (March 4) in Westville, Ind. The semifinals are slated for Friday evening and the championship game is on Sunday in Indiana. Purdue Northwest will host the final three rounds of the league tournament later this week with the women playing in Westville and the men in Hammond.

The other first-round matchups in the GLIAC Women's Basketball Tournament on Tuesday include 12th-seeded Lake Superior State visiting fifth-seeded Wayne State, #11 Purdue Northwest venturing to #6 Ashland along with #10 Davenport headed to #7 Northern Michigan. The top four seeded teams all received opening round byes, including #1 Michigan Tech, #2 Grand Valley State, #3 Northwood and #4 Saginaw Valley State. The remaining teams will be reseeded following Tuesday's first-round.

The winner of the GLIAC Tournament receives an automatic bid into the NCAA Division II Midwest Regional Tournament slated to be held March 12-15 in Springfield, Mo.

Ferris has posted a 11-16 overall record in 17 previous league women's basketball tournament appearances and will be making its fourth-straight appearance in the field after making its first since the 2012-13 campaign back in 2018. FSU has finished as the tournament runner-up three times and reached the semifinal round in eight of its 17 previous trips to the league event.

Last year, the Bulldogs narrowly fell 78-76 at home to Wayne State in the quarterfinal round after claiming the GLIAC North Division Championship. FSU went on to receive the school's first NCAA Division II Tournament berth since 2012 before the event was cancelled due to the COVID-19 pandemic.
